Begin by determining how many people will need transportation. Include church members, youth participants, leaders, volunteers, and other attendees.
Next, create a detailed itinerary. Include pickup locations, destinations, scheduled stops, meal breaks, event times, and return transportation.
Consider the length of the trip and the amount of luggage or equipment passengers will bring. Youth groups may have personal bags, while ministry teams may need room for instruments or supplies.
It is also helpful to appoint a transportation coordinator who can communicate with the bus provider and answer questions from church members.
Church events, retreats, conferences, and holiday activities can take place during busy travel periods. Booking transportation in advance gives organizers more time to plan the trip.
Early planning also allows church leaders to communicate the transportation schedule to members and parents.
Before departure, make sure passengers know the pickup location, boarding time, destination, and expected return schedule. Clear communication can help the trip run smoothly.
